Sdílet prostřednictvím


SrgsDocument.PhoneticAlphabet Vlastnost

Definice

Získá nebo nastaví fonetickou abecedu SrgsDocument třídy.

public:
 property System::Speech::Recognition::SrgsGrammar::SrgsPhoneticAlphabet PhoneticAlphabet { System::Speech::Recognition::SrgsGrammar::SrgsPhoneticAlphabet get(); void set(System::Speech::Recognition::SrgsGrammar::SrgsPhoneticAlphabet value); };
public System.Speech.Recognition.SrgsGrammar.SrgsPhoneticAlphabet PhoneticAlphabet { get; set; }
member this.PhoneticAlphabet : System.Speech.Recognition.SrgsGrammar.SrgsPhoneticAlphabet with get, set
Public Property PhoneticAlphabet As SrgsPhoneticAlphabet

Hodnota vlastnosti

Vrátí fonetickou abecedu, která musí být použita k určení vlastní výslovnosti v objektu SrgsToken .

Poznámky

Fonetické abecedy se skládají z telefonů, které se skládají z písmen, číslic nebo znaků, někdy v kombinaci. Každý telefon popisuje jedinečný zvuk řeči. To je v kontrastu s latinkou, pro kterou může každé písmeno představovat více mluvených zvuků. Zvažte různé výslovnosti písmen "c" ve slovech "candy" a "cease", nebo různé výslovnosti kombinace písmen "th" ve slovech "věc" a "ty".

V System.Speech můžete k určení vlastní výslovnosti použít libovolnou ze tří fonetických abeced: Mezinárodní telefonní abeceda (IPA), UPS (Universal Phone Set) nebo sada telefonů SAPI. Zadaná fonetická abeceda určuje, která sada telefonů se použije k definování vložených výslovností objektů SrgsToken . Telefony zadané v Pronunciation souboru se musí shodovat s fonetickou abecedou zadanou v PhoneticAlphabet.

Další informace najdete v článku Lexikony a fonetické abecedy .

Platí pro